深入探讨Clash的端口配置

一、什么是Clash?

Clash是一款优秀的网络代理工具,通过规则配置,为用户提供灵活的代理服务。它广泛应用于科学上网,具备高效和高度可定制的特性。而其中,端口配置是顺畅使用Clash的关键部分之一。

二、Clash的端口功能

在Clash软件中,每种服务及其功能要求都需要对应的端口去监听和管理。默认情况下,Clash的流量通过特定的端口进行管理、转发与监听。

2.1 安装后默认端口

通常,在Clash成功安装并启动后,系统会预设以下几种端口:

  • HTTP:7890端口
  • SOCKS5:7891端口
  • Redir:7892端口

这些端口可以帮助用户快速启用Clash,让他们无需过多的手动配置,就能够顺利地上网。

三、如何更改Clash的端口配置?

如果你想为Clash软件更改端口配置,步骤非常简单。

3.1 修改配置文件

  1. 找到你的Clash配置文件,通常配置文件位于 ~/.config/clash/config.yaml

  2. 使用文本编辑器打开该文件。

  3. 定位到代理服务部分,找到其端口设置,可能如下所示: yaml port: 7890 socks-port: 7891 redir-port: 7892

  4. 按需修改这些数字。

  5. 保存更改并重启Clash服务以使更改生效。

3.2 示例:修改为8000端口

如果要将HTTP端口更换为8000,修改部分应变为: yaml port: 8000 socks-port: 7891 redir-port: 7892

更改时应确保端口不与本地其他应用程序发生冲突。

四、Clash端口的常见问题

4.1 如何确认端口是否成功修改?

运行以下命令行验证端口使用情况: bash netstat -tuln | grep ‘8000’

如果看到该端口正在运行,则修改成功。

4.2 如果端口冲突该怎么办?

  • 在配置文件中检查相关端口配置,以确保未更改为其他正在被使用的端口。
  • 尝试使用不同的端口号,如8080或8888。

4.3 How to find the port used by Clash?

Clash的默认端口可以在其配置文件中设置或查找,也可以通过运行相关命令来确认端口状态。

五、使用Clash的其他注意事项

5.1 确保Firewall允许端口流量

在许多系统中,如Windows,Linux系统的Firewall可能会阻止配置好的端口。因此确保在系统防火墙中设置白名单和例外规则。

5.2 针对运行效能定期进行安全检查

安全地使用Clash并确保所选的端口是安全和高效的。其配置更新后不可再次导致整个平台流量问题。保持软件更新和修复。

六、结论

Clash是一款功能强大的工具,通过合理的端口配置,你可以改善上网体验,更高效和灵活地使用网络资源。对于新手而言,记住端口配置的基本规则对于有效管理流量是至关重要的。本篇文章希望对您了解Clash的端口配置有所帮助。

常见问题解答(FAQ)

问:Clash能处理哪些类型的流量?
答:Clash可以处理 HTTP、HTTPS 以及 SOCKS 代理流量。

问:如何查看Clash当前的连接状态和端口使用?
答:可以通过命令 netstat -tuln 或者在Clash的地址发现正在监听的端口和应用.*

正文完
 0